Abstract

An automation and motion control system for theatrical objects, such as theatrical props, cameras, stunt persons, lighting, scenery, drapery or other similar types of devices or items, is provided to coordinate the movement of the objects on a large scale and/or to control the operation of the objects.

Claims (12)

1. An automation and motion control system to control a plurality of theatrical objects, the control system comprising:

a plurality of nodes in communication with each other over a real time network, wherein each node of the plurality of nodes corresponds to at least one item of equipment used to control at least one of the theatrical objects;

each node of the plurality of nodes comprising a microprocessor and a memory device;

the memory device comprising a node process and at least one control process executable by the microprocessor;

the at least one control process being used to control an operation of the at least one item of equipment; and

the at least one control process having one or more of cues, rules and actions to generate one or more control instructions to control the operation of the at least one item of equipment;

wherein a space device is implemented into at least one node of the plurality of nodes to simulate a motion routine of an object to be moved by the at least one node in a predefined space prior to implementation of the motion routine.

2. The automation and motion control system of claim 1 wherein each node of the plurality of nodes has a unique network address.

3. The automation and motion control system of claim 1 wherein the space device controls both a position and an orientation of the object to be moved in the predefined space.

4. The automation and motion control system of claim 1 wherein the plurality of nodes correspond to one or more of machinery, input/output devices, external systems, safety systems, remote stations and operator consoles.

5. The automation and motion control system of claim 1 wherein the space device evaluates a possibility of a collision during a simulation of the motion routine of the object to be moved.

6. The automation and motion control system of claim 5 wherein the space device reports the possibility of the collision to an operator.
